Long excursion 12" woofer with 800W power handling for
subwoofer application. A special 3" copper voice coil using
proprietary high temperature adhesives and an optimized
magnet assembly guarantees superb LF dynamic range with a
very low distortion. Due to the linear characteristics of the 12
PZ 32, exceptional results are obtained in horn loaded
subwoofer applications.

1 2 hours test made with continuous pink noise signal (6 dB crest factor) within the
specified range. Power calculated on rated minimum impedance. Loudspeaker in
free air.
2 Power on Continuous Program is defined as 3 dB greater than the Nominal rating.
3 Applied RMS Voltage is set to 2.83V for 8 ohms Nominal Impedance. Average
SPL from 200 to 2500 Hz.
4 Thiele-Small parameters are measured after a high level 20 Hz sine wave preconditioning
test.

| The B&C 12NW100 speaker is designed to produce bass, it is typically a 12 inch usable as a bass power speaker in a subwoofer for a compact system often transported. The 12NW100 will delight you with bass-reflex or band-pass load, its significant admissible electrical power makes it a real machine for producing bass, however, special care must be taken with the amplification dedicated to it.

This classic guitar speaker actually started life as a radio speaker that was modified specifically for use in electric guitar amplifiers. In its original incarnation as the G12 T530 it appeared in several colour variations, but it was the Blue version, fitted as standard into Vox AC30 amps, that secured its place in guitar tone history.
The Blue found favour with notable guitarists like Brian May, due to its glorious dampened attack, warm lows, mellow upper-mids and brilliant belllike top-end. When coupled with a suitable amplifier it evokes rich definition and develops beautiful musical compression when pushed. According to tone enthusiasts worldwide, the Blue is the benchmark for guitar speaker perfection.
